NBM:梅内特基底核

“Nucleus Basalis of Meynert”在医学和生理学领域常被简称为NBM,以方便书写和使用。该结构位于大脑前脑基底区,是胆碱能神经元的重要聚集区域,在中枢神经系统的功能调节中起着关键作用。其中文译名为“梅内特基底核”,是学习和认知功能相关研究中的常用术语。
